Meet Elize
Elize is a New Zealand Registered Dietitian, a member of Dietitians New Zealand, and the past president of the Auckland branch of Dietitians New Zealand. She’s also co-convenor of the Bariatric Special Interest Group.
Graduating Massey University with a BSc with first-class honours, Elize then worked towards her MHSc in nutrition and dietetics at the University of Auckland before kicking off her working career developing and then teaching courses in chemistry, nutritional biochemistry, clinical, and human nutrition. Elize then moved into a clinical role with the Waitemata DHB as a hospital dietitian, working across Waitakere and North Shore hospitals in a variety of specialities. She set up her own full-time private practice in 2018, predominantly specialising in gastroenterology, bariatric surgery, disordered eating, general nutrition, and healthy eating advice. Elize has in-depth knowledge of nutritional research, gut health, bariatric surgery including 2+ years post-surgery care, weight regain and pregnancy nutrition, and disordered eating. She advocates for and facilitates positive behavioural change using both client-focused and evidence-based approaches. |
